physically-distant
Adjective
/ˈfɪzɪkəlɪ ˈdɪstənt/

Definition
Relating to the state of being physically apart from others, often for safety or health reasons.

Examples
- During the pandemic, many people had to adopt a physically-distant lifestyle.
- Schools implemented physically-distant seating arrangements to ensure student safety.
- Virtual meetings became popular as a way to interact while remaining physically-distant.

Meaning
The term ‘physically-distant’ refers to maintaining space between individuals to prevent close contact, especially during situations like a pandemic.
